一、分布式查询链接服务器
二、创建分布式查询链接服务器的重要性
数据整合:打破数据孤岛,实现多源数据的无缝整合。
提高查询效率:通过优化查询路径,减少数据传输量,提升查询响应速度。
增强数据安全性:集中管理数据访问权限,加强数据安全保护。
简化开发流程:为开发者提供统一的访问接口,降低开发复杂度。
三、创建分布式查询链接服务器的步骤
步骤 描述 1. 需求分析 明确业务需求,确定需要连接的数据源类型及数量。 2. 环境准备 确保所有目标数据库可访问,并安装必要的中间件或驱动程序。 3. 选择工具 根据需求选择合适的分布式查询工具,如Apache Drill、Presto等。 4. 配置链接 在选定的工具中配置各数据源的连接信息,包括数据库地址、端口、用户名、密码等。 5. 测试验证 执行测试查询,验证各数据源是否成功连接并能正确返回数据。 6. 性能优化 根据测试结果调整配置,优化查询性能。 7. 文档记录 记录配置过程、参数设置及遇到的问题和解决方案,便于后续维护。
四、注意事项
确保网络连通性:检查所有数据源之间的网络连接是否正常。
数据格式一致性:尽量保证各数据源中数据的格式一致,便于查询和处理。
权限管理:合理分配访问权限,避免未授权访问。
监控与日志:实施监控机制,记录查询日志,便于问题追踪和性能分析。
五、FAQs
A1: 是的,但具体取决于所使用的分布式查询工具及其配置,一些高级工具如Apache Kafka配合KSQL,可以实现实时数据流处理和查询。
Q2: 创建分布式查询链接服务器时,如何处理数据源之间的数据冲突?
A2: 数据冲突处理策略需根据业务需求定制,常见的方法包括数据合并规则定义、优先级设定、冲突数据标记及人工干预等。
小编有话说
创建分布式查询链接服务器是一个复杂但极具价值的过程,它不仅能够提升企业的数据处理能力,还能为数据分析和决策提供强有力的支持,在实施过程中,务必注重需求分析、环境准备、工具选择、配置测试及性能优化等关键环节,同时不忘记录和分享经验教训,希望本文能为您的分布式查询之旅提供有益的参考和指导。